Comparison of the MRI and Integrated PET/CT Findings in the Preoperative Detection of Peritoneal Carcinomatosis Arising from Primary Ovarian Cancer

Description

To compare the diagnostic performance of MRI and integrated PET/CT for the preoperative detection of peritoneal carcinomatosis arising from primary ovarian cancer. Twenty-three patients with suspected ovarian tumors underwent a contrast-enhanced 1.5 Tesla MRI and a 18F-fluorodeoxyglucose (FDG) PET/CT prior to surgery. The peritoneal cavity was subdivided into six specific sites for a lesion- based analysis. The imaging findings were compared statistically with the histopathological findings using McNemar's test with Bonferroni's adjustment and generalized estimation equations. The histopathological results of all 23 patients were confirmed for primary malignant epithelial ovarian cancer. Of the 23 patients, 19 had a total of 83 sites with peritoneal seedings throughout the abdomen and pelvis. The comparison of the patient- based sensitivity, specificity and accuracy of the use of MRI versus PET/CT for the detection of peritoneal carcinomatosis were 95% versus 84% (p > 0.05; N.S.), 50% versus 50% (p > 0.05; N.S.), and 87% versus 78% (p > 0.05; N.S.), respectively. Moreover, the comparison of the lesion-based sensitivity, specificity and accuracy of MRI versus integrated PET/CT were 86% and 75% (p = 0.004), 76% and 84% (p > 0.05; N.S.), and 82% and 78% (p > 0.05; N.S.), respectively. We found that MRI was more sensitive than integrated PET/CT for the detection of preoperative peritoneal carcinomatosis arising from primary ovarian cancer
